News - 13th Annual Dance Music Submit Hits Las Vegas

13th Annual Dance Music Submit Hits Las Vegas

Posted by Michael Yu, Sep 05, 10:57 AM EST

Now in it's 13th year, Billboard's annual Dance Music Summit, will take place in Las Vegas this year from September 17-20 at the Palms Casino Resort. Considered dance music industry’s most important business-to-business event, this year hosts a handful of panelists with appearances by Kristine W., Jody Watley, Ferry Corsten, Kaskade and Junkie XL. The Las Vegas Strip evolved from Rat Pack central to a graveyard for musicians at the end of their careers. It has risen to the benchmark for nightlife success; an escape into an abyss of light and sound with over 28 clubs and lounges serving locals and tourists 52 weeks and weekends a year ...all within less than a two mile radius. Join the movers and shakers of the Las Vegas club community for a timely discussion on how to succeed and expand in today's nightclubbing universe.
